The aim of this study was to validate the iHealth BP7 wireless wrist blood pressure monitor according to the European Society of Hypertension International Protocol (ESH-IP) revision 2010.
A total of 99 pairs of test device and reference blood pressure measurements (three pairs for each of the 33 participants) were obtained for validation. The ESH-IP revision 2010 for the validation of blood pressure measuring devices in adults was followed precisely.
The device produced 66, 87, and 97 measurements within 5, 10, and 15 mmHg for systolic blood pressure (SBP) and 72, 93, and 99 mmHg for diastolic blood pressure (DBP), respectively. The mean±SD device-observer difference was -0.7±6.9 mmHg for SBP and -1.0±5.1 mmHg for DBP. The number of participants with two or three device-observer differences within 5 mmHg was 25 for SBP and 26 for DBP; furthermore, there were three participants for SBP and one participant for DBP, with none of the device-observer differences within 5 mmHg.
On the basis of the validation results, the iHealth BP7 wireless wrist blood pressure monitor can be recommended for self-measurement in an adult population.
